#### Applying k8s manifest
> Alpha0 (Stable)
```bash
kubectl apply -f https://raw.githubusercontent.com/litmuschaos/litmus/v1.8.x/litmus-portal/k8s-manifest.yml
```
Or
> Master (Latest)
```bash
kubectl apply -f https://raw.githubusercontent.com/litmuschaos/litmus/master/litmus-portal/k8s-manifest.yml
```

### **User Guide for Litmus Portal**
<br>
Litmus-Portal provides console or UI experience for managing, monitoring, and events round chaos workflows. Chaos workflows consist of a sequence of experiments run together to achieve the objective of introducing some kind of fault into an application or the Kubernetes platform.
